Author(s): Ryota Nakai and Hayato Goto Quantum error-correcting codes (QECCs) require high encoding rates in addition to high thresholds unless a sufficiently large number of physical qubits are available. Many-hypercube (MHC) codes, defined as concatenations of the [ [ 6 , 4 , 2 ] ] quantum error-detecting code, have been proposed as high-perfo… [Phys. Rev.
